Q: Is 707,864 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 707,864 is a composite number.

Why is 707,864 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 707,864 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 19 38 76 152 4,657 9,314 18,628 37,256 88,483 176,966 353,932 and 707,864, with no remainder.

Since 707,864 cannot be divided by just 1 and 707,864, it is a composite number.
